一个很简单的asterisk通过AMI重新加载拨号规则的例子:
include_once("phpagi-asmanager.php"); //这个文件可以下载,没有找到的可以找我要
$asm = new AGI_AsteriskManager();
$res = $asm->connect();
if( $res==TRUE ) {
echo " AMI Connection established.\n";
} else {
echo "AMI Connection failed.\n"; //AMI连接失败
}
//这里相当于 在asterisk 中执行 dialplan reload命令
$result = $asm->Command("dialplan reload");
echo "";
// print_r($result); //输出执行该命令的结果
?>
阅读(39113) | 评论(0) | 转发(0) |